How Does That Grab You? is the second studio album by Nancy Sinatra, released on Reprise Records in 1966.[2] Arranged and conducted by Billy Strange, the album was produced by Lee Hazlewood.[3] It peaked at number 41 on the Billboard 200 chart.[4] The single, "How Does That Grab You, Darlin'?", reached number 7 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art,[5] as well as number 19 on the UK Singles Chart.[6]
